Career Role (Toolmaking & Precision Engineering) Description
CNC Machinist Operates and programs Computer Numerical Control (CNC) machines for precise metal cutting and shaping. High demand, excellent earning potential.
Toolmaker Creates and maintains precision tools and dies, crucial for various manufacturing processes. Highly skilled, strong job security.
Jig & Fixture Maker Designs and constructs jigs and fixtures to guide and hold workpieces during manufacturing operations. In-demand specialized skillset.
CAD/CAM Programmer Develops and implements computer-aided design (CAD) and computer-aided manufacturing (CAM) programs for toolmaking. Strong technical role.
Toolroom Technician Maintains and repairs precision tooling and machinery in a toolroom environment. Essential role in maintaining productivity.
